Celprom

Rue Du Croissant 150, Belgium

Celprom is a leading designer and manufacturer of promotional and industrial products, leveraging advanced fabrication processes including thermoforming, CNC milling, laser cutting, die cutting, stamping, molding, hot folding, polishing, and diverse gluing and assembly methods. Expertise spans plastics and materials such as plexiglass, Forex, polystyrene, polypropylene sheets and corrugated polypropylene, PVC, PETG, polycarbonate, wood (MDF, multiplex, particle board), Dibond, foam, fine cardboard, corrugated cardboard, Kapa, aluminum, resins, expanded polystyrene, PRAL/Corian, and decodur. Specializing in the production, finishing, and customization of suitcases, briefcases, boxes, and injected or thermoformed packaging, Celprom serves as exclusive agent for Plasticase in Belgium. Custom production capabilities include stamped or milled foams, thermoformed parts, and cut cardboard for cushioning or presentation within luggage solutions. Celprom supports multiple industries with reliable expertise and scalable manufacturing in advertising, communication, marketing, events, design, Horeca, food, confectionery, and household appliances, while also operating as a subcontractor in signage, printing, construction, decor manufacturing, automotive, pharmaceuticals, heating, electronics, mechanics, and electrical sectors. Requirements

  • Define requirements: prototype processes, materials, tolerances, throughput, budget, service levels, certification needs.
  • Map total spend and scope: machines, accessories, consumables, software, installation, training, maintenance, spares.
  • Build supplier longlist: OEMs, authorized dealers, specialist integrators, local service partners.
  • Screen capabilities: compatible technologies, build size, accuracy, repeatability, material range, post-processing support.
  • Verify quality and compliance: ISO, CE/UL, calibration, traceability, documentation, HSE, export/import compliance.
  • Assess reliability and performance: uptime history, references, demo/POC results, install base, warranty terms.
  • Check service and support: response times, local technicians, spare parts stock, remote diagnostics, preventive maintenance.
  • Evaluate total cost of ownership: purchase price, consumables, energy, maintenance, downtime risk, upgrades, training.
  • Review commercial terms: lead times, MOQ, payment terms, Incoterms, pricing validity, exchange rates, volume discounts.
  • Assess supplier viability: financial stability, capacity, roadmap, obsolescence risk, continuity plans.
  • Confirm integration fit: CAD/CAM, PLM, MES, ERP, data security, automation, facility requirements, utilities.
  • Run pilot and approval: sample parts, acceptance criteria, sign-off from engineering, quality, operations, procurement.
  • Negotiate contract: SLAs, KPIs, penalties, service credits, warranty scope, IP, confidentiality, change control.
  • Plan onboarding: project owner, milestones, installation, acceptance testing, user training, SOPs, spare parts list.
  • Set governance: supplier scorecard, QBR cadence, issue escalation, inventory review, continuous improvement plan.

Best practices

  • 1. Define your prototyping requirements clearly by material, size, tolerance, speed, and volume before purchasing.
  • 2. Match the machine type to your use case, such as 3D printing, CNC, laser cutting, or vacuum forming.
  • 3. Evaluate total cost of ownership, including maintenance, consumables, training, software, and downtime.
  • 4. Verify compatibility with your existing CAD/CAM software and production workflows.
  • 5. Choose equipment with scalable capacity to support future growth and changing project demands.
  • 6. Prioritize accuracy, repeatability, and build quality over lowest upfront price.
  • 7. Check supplier reputation, service responsiveness, spare parts availability, and warranty coverage.
  • 8. Ensure operators receive proper training and that safety standards and certifications are met.
  • 9. Plan for required accessories, tooling, fixtures, calibration tools, and post-processing equipment.
  • 10. Assess material availability, material certifications, and vendor lock-in risks before buying.
  • 11. Require sample runs, demos, or pilot testing to validate performance on real parts.
  • 12. Set up preventive maintenance schedules and documentation from day one.
  • 13. Consider integration with quality control systems for inspection, traceability, and reporting.
  • 14. Review installation needs such as power, ventilation, footprint, and environmental controls.
  • 15. Build a procurement process that includes stakeholder input from engineering, operations, finance, and quality teams.
